Shocking! Thane: 3 customers kill idli vendor following dispute over Rs 20

In a shocking incidet a 26-six-year-old Idli vendor was allegedly murdered by three customers over a dispute of Rs 20 at Mira Road in Maharashtra’s Thane district on Friday.

The victim has been identified as Virendra Amritlal Yadav, a resident of Azad Nagar. As per police investigation, Yadav got into an argument with his three customers over payment of Rs 20 for the Idlis. The three suspects then pushed Yadav who fell down and received head injuries.

After pushing Yadav the accused fled from the spot. Locals rushed Yadav to a nearby hospital, but he was declared dead by the doctors.

A senior police officer from Naya Nagar police station said "Yadav was declared dead before admission at the hospital. The primary report suggested that he had died to severe head injuries that he received due to the fall he suffered after being pushed by the accused."

Police authorities also located a CCTV video of the suspected individuals. The footage is being circulated at various police stations across Mira Bhayander Commissionerate, Mumbai, and surrounding areas of Thane and Palghar to nab the accused.
